EBC, also known as Empresa Brasil de Comunicacao, is a state-owned company headquartered in Brazil. Founded in 2007, the company employs approximately 1570 individuals and reported $94.3M in revenue as of 2024. Its main product involves broadcast television and radio. Functioning as a tier 1 media tech buyer, the company is responsible for the content and management of TV Brasil, eight EBC radio stations, the news agency Agência Brasil, the audio news agency Radioagência Nacional, and the EBC Portal.
On March 16, 2026, Xinhua News Agency President Fu Hua met with André Basbaum, president of Brazil's public broadcasting company Empresa Brasil de Comunicação (EBC), in Beijing. Previously, on December 19, 2025, EBC subsidiary Canal Gov broadcast the "Bom Dia Ministra" program, where Minister Margareth Menezes highlighted the financial impact of Brazil's Rouanet Law. Menezes stated that for every R$ 1 invested, R$ 7 returns to society, citing a Fundação Getúlio Vargas (FGV) study that reported the law moved R$ 25.7 billion in 2024, generating 228,000 jobs and impacting nearly 90 million people. This followed the BRICS Media and Think Tank Forum, which EBC co-hosted with Xinhua News Agency in Rio de Janeiro on July 16, 2025.
